Output 21e58562a97a7752b8093cd1f2f2dea6dcf154333b260d194734e6afeb3c90f2:0

value
274747068
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d68b04130fcd36fd06a5d186999089f31b365d97 OP_EQUALVERIFY OP_CHECKSIG
address
LenMQG2XPhMM9LCnmuAvRWrmsf2h5Yaf3R
transaction
21e58562a97a7752b8093cd1f2f2dea6dcf154333b260d194734e6afeb3c90f2
spent
true